Thailand is a fantastic destination for families, offering a mix of cultural experiences, outdoor adventures, and relaxing beach getaways. Whether you’re travelling with young children or teenagers, there are plenty of activities to keep everyone entertained. This guide explores the best family-friendly activities and tours in Thailand to make your trip unforgettable.

1. Explore Bangkok’s Kid-Friendly Attractions

Visit SEA LIFE Bangkok Ocean World

  • One of the largest aquariums in Southeast Asia, featuring sharks, penguins, and exotic sea creatures.
  • Kids will love the glass-bottom boat ride and 4D cinema experience.

Enjoy a Fun Day at Safari World

  • A wildlife park with a drive-through safari and live animal shows.
  • See lions, giraffes, dolphins, and exotic birds up close.

Take a Chao Phraya River Boat Ride

  • A scenic boat trip that allows kids to see Bangkok’s famous landmarks, such as the Grand Palace and Wat Arun.
  • Hop-on, hop-off boats make it an easy and enjoyable experience for families.

2. Visit Ethical Elephant Sanctuaries

Elephant Nature Park (Chiang Mai)

  • A responsible sanctuary where families can observe rescued elephants in their natural habitat.
  • No riding—just feeding, walking, and learning about elephant conservation.

Phuket Elephant Sanctuary

  • Offers a half-day experience where kids can interact with elephants ethically.
  • Learn about elephant rescue efforts and witness elephants roaming freely.

3. Take a Family-Friendly Thai Cooking Class

  • Learn how to make Pad Thai, Mango Sticky Rice, and Spring Rolls with hands-on guidance.
  • Many cooking schools in Bangkok, Chiang Mai, and Phuket offer kid-friendly classes.

4. Enjoy a Beach Holiday on Thailand’s Best Family-Friendly Islands

Phuket – The Ultimate Family Destination

  • Visit Patong Beach for water sports or Kata Beach for a quieter family vibe.
  • Take a boat trip to Phang Nga Bay and James Bond Island.

Koh Samui – Relaxed Beach Fun

  • Swim in calm, shallow waters at Silver Beach or Lipa Noi Beach.
  • Visit the Pink Dolphin Tour for a chance to see rare dolphins in the wild.

Krabi – Island Adventures for Families

  • Take a long-tail boat tour to Railay Beach and the Four Islands.
  • Explore the Emerald Pool and Hot Springs for a fun nature experience.

5. Experience Thailand’s Best Theme Parks

Dream World (Bangkok)

  • A fun amusement park featuring roller coasters, water rides, and Snow Town.
  • Perfect for younger kids who love fairytale-themed attractions.

Ramayana Water Park (Pattaya)

  • Thailand’s biggest water park with slides, wave pools, and lazy rivers.
  • A great place to cool off and enjoy a day of water fun.

6. Discover Thailand’s Floating Markets

Damnoen Saduak Floating Market (Bangkok)

  • Ride a traditional long-tail boat and explore vibrant floating market stalls.
  • Kids can enjoy tasting Thai snacks and fresh coconut ice cream.

Amphawa Floating Market

  • Less touristy than Damnoen Saduak and offers firefly boat tours at night.
  • Try delicious grilled seafood and traditional Thai sweets.

7. Go on a Jungle Adventure

Khao Sok National Park (Southern Thailand)

  • Stay in a floating bungalow on Cheow Lan Lake and take a family-friendly safari tour.
  • Go kayaking, swimming, and spot monkeys, hornbills, and elephants.

Flight of the Gibbon Zipline (Chiang Mai)

  • A safe and thrilling canopy zipline adventure for older kids and teens.
  • Offers a unique way to experience Thailand’s rainforests.

8. Visit Thailand’s Interactive Museums

Art in Paradise (Bangkok & Chiang Mai)

  • A 3D art museum where kids can take fun interactive photos with optical illusions.
  • One of the best indoor activities for families on a rainy day.

Children’s Discovery Museum (Bangkok)

  • A hands-on museum with science exhibits, water play zones, and adventure playgrounds.
  • Great for younger kids to learn while playing.

9. Take a Night Safari in Chiang Mai

  • A guided tram tour through a nocturnal zoo where kids can see tigers, zebras, and elephants.
  • Includes fun animal feeding sessions and light shows.
